Why we’re obsessed with Pamela and Neeson’s love story

The sparks seemingly began to fly while the pair were shooting the new The Naked Gun film, in which Neeson, 73, plays the lead and Anderson, 58, his love interest. Way back in October, the internet couldn't help noticing the way the Taken actor gushed when asked about his costar. “With Pamela, first off, 'm madly in love with her,” he told People. “She's just terrific to work with. | can't compliment her enough, Ill be honest with you.”

And when it came time to promote the film in press junkets and interviews this summer, their chemistry on screen had noticeably leapt into the real world. They posed with their arms around each other on the red carpet, visibly relaxed and delighted by each other's presence, natural gesture that has all the hallmarks of belonging to an established couple.
